I (Terry Meehan, MGI) am generating cross-product definitions in the Cell Ontology. To do this, I load the Cell ontology (CL), the three GO ontologies, PR0 and the Uberon ontology. I accidentally generated a cyclical relationship between the two terms after reasoning (see pictures). I *think* this resulted from using two related GO processes in the cross-product definition but am not sure due to some buggy issues.

  1. The "Explanation" feature both in the graph editor and in the Assert Implied links panel fail to explain reasoning. This is an issue Amina and Chris are aware of.
  2. Perhaps related... the Parent editor fails to show implied links, even when the checkbox is checked.
  3. Tree editor fails to show any relationship between the two terms.
  4. Should have the verification manager prevented this cyclical relationship from occurring? The reasoner stopped running checks due to the number of errors (>200). Most of these errors are miss-spellings in Uberon.

Discussion with Amina, Chris and David. Amina: Explanation feature to be worked on. Terry: Graph to be simplified. Terry: Perhaps load into Protege 4 and see if different results show. Terry: Check file in? Yes, will do later.

Next question:

Verification checker showing more than 200 non-fatal errors. Does it still look for fatal errors or does it just stop looking after 200 non-fatal errors? David: I think it still finds fatal errors.

David: Using OBOMerge and having a subtle issue. If def changed in both files only the first def is kept. The other is overwritten. This is in the tracker with full details. Would be better if the merged term kept both defs and flagged to the user to go back and fix. https://sourceforge.net/tracker/?func=detail&aid=2880542&group_id=36855&atid=418257 Could also just treat as a clash and cause merge failure.

Amina has managed to reproduce the bug that Jen sees in the source version of OBO-Edit where no relationships can be added.

Amina is going to make the release and then we can do a lot of testing. Chris suggests that we should make it a beta release, since there are a number of fixes that haven't yet been tested.

David is having trouble with memory preference being stuck at 1024M on installation. No matter how he changes it is always reverts. He has not tried directly editing the vmoptions file. It is the configuration manager that has the problem. (vmoptions in the installation directory)
